Episode Highlights
Facing Adversity
Hal Elrod's journey through adversity, including his battle with a rare and aggressive form of cancer, has profoundly shaped his perspective on life. He shares that facing a 20% to 30% chance of survival pushed him to double down on his Miracle Morning routine, emphasizing the importance of mindset in overcoming challenges 1. Hal believes that every adversity is an opportunity for growth and transformation, stating, "On the other side of the adversity is a better version of ourselves if and only if we take it on without mindset" 2. His experience underscores the power of resilience and the role of personal responsibility in navigating life's toughest moments.

Commitment
The power of daily commitment is central to Hal's philosophy, particularly through his Miracle Morning routine. He shares that maintaining this routine consistently over 15 years has been transformative, allowing him to start each day in a peak physical, mental, emotional, and spiritual state 3. Hal notes, "Every day you do a miracle morning, you're putting yourself in a peak physical, mental, emotional and spiritual state" 3. This commitment not only enhances personal well-being but also enriches every area of life, demonstrating the contagious nature of positive habits 4.

Limiting Beliefs
Overcoming limiting beliefs is a crucial step in personal growth, as Hal Elrod illustrates through his own experiences. He challenges the notion of not being a "morning person," describing it as a limiting belief that can be overcome with the right mindset and habits 5. Hal's thoughtful approach to writing his book, "The Miracle Morning," involved anticipating and addressing these beliefs, helping readers transition from resistance to embracing new habits 6. He emphasizes, "The second to the last chapter in the Miracle Morning book is called From Unbearable to Unstoppable," highlighting the journey from initial resistance to sustained change.
